In November 2000, village residents overwhelmingly voted to fund the acquisition of open space in the village. As a result, Irvington was able to purchase and preserve 40 acres of the Irvington Woods, with the help of Westchester County, NY State, Scenic Hudson Land Trust, and the Open Space Institute. Revitalizing the trails became a community-wide effort, with important contributions from the Boy Scouts, Girl Scouts, Irvington Cross Country Team, Irvington Recreation Department and Irvington Trailways Committee.
